One way of attaining this with out including in additional dependencies or comparable is fairly reduced tech, but it really works:
Static Array: Fixed sizing array (its dimension ought to be declared In the beginning and may not be transformed afterwards)
You take Every aspect and compare it with its children to examine In case the pair conforms towards the heap principles. So, hence, the leaves get included in the heap free of charge.
With Eclipse Collections There are several various ways to initialize a Set made up of the characters 'a' and 'b' in one assertion.
Collection literals were being scheduled for Java seven, but didn't make it in. So nothing automated but. You need to use guava's Sets:
The mission on the Division is in order that all eligible residents have access to obtainable companies and packages that enrich the satisfaction of lifetime and enrich a various dwelling environment in a secure community.
This time There's no require to mention the scale within the box bracket. Even a simple variant of the is:
Verify the Place of sq. integrable vector valed features is separable a lot more sizzling queries
At last, the inside of São Paulo state is house to a number of compact cities and villages that supply a true style of Brazilian daily life. Home prices During this area are extremely fair, which makes it a great selection for retirement or expenditure functions.
Then a purely natural dilemma is why we'd like overloaded versions when Now we have var-args? The answer is: each var-arg process generates an array internally and getting the overloaded variations would keep away from pointless generation of object and will likely preserve us in the rubbish collection overhead.
For filling with incremental integer values or just initialize the set of duration n with value x we can easily do:
If you're looking for any worthwhile financial commitment option, you should definitely think about São Paulo State property. Listed here are 5 industrial warehouse main reasons why:
Or, go in the other course: get started at the conclusion of the array and shift backwards to the entrance. At each iteration, you sift an item down till it really is in the proper locale.
The siftUp Procedure is only required to conduct inserts into an existing heap, so It will be accustomed to put into action a precedence queue utilizing a binary heap, as an example.